What are URL shorteners?
URL shorteners are online tools or services that convert long, complex web addresses into shorter, more manageable links without changing the destination page.
These shortened URLs are easier to share on social media, emails, and other digital platforms where space is limited or readability matters. Popular examples include: Replug, Bitly, TinyURL, and Rebrandly.
Beyond just shortening links, modern URL shorteners often provide additional features such as click tracking, analytics, custom aliases, and branded domains. This allows businesses and individuals to monitor engagement and enhance their marketing strategies.
By simplifying lengthy URLs, these tools improve user experience, link aesthetics, and shareability across platforms.
How does a URL shortener work?
A URL shortener works by creating a unique, compact identifier that redirects users to the original long URL.
When a user inputs a long web address into a shortening service, the system stores that URL in its database and generates a short, unique code, usually a random string of letters and numbers.
This code is appended to the shortener’s domain (e.g., replug.io/abc123). When someone clicks the shortened link, the shortener’s server looks up the corresponding original URL and instantly redirects the user to that destination using an HTTP 301 or 302 redirect response. This process happens in milliseconds.
Advanced URL shorteners also track user interactions, such as click count, location, device type, and time of access, providing valuable insights for analytics and digital marketing optimization.

What does it mean to add multiple links in one link?
Adding “multiple links in one link” means you share a single URL that points to a landing page containing many different destinations.
Instead of posting separate URLs for a website, shop, YouTube channel, and lead magnet, you give people one gateway link. When someone taps this master link, they land on a simple page that lists buttons or cards for every place you want to send them.
This approach is often called a link-in-bio, link hub, or link aggregation. It is very different from dropping several URLs in a caption, which can look cluttered and hard to click, especially on mobile.
A well-built bio link page is mobile-first, fast to scan, and easy to tap with a thumb. For platforms that limit bios to one clickable link, this is the cleanest way to turn that single spot into a full link menu.
For example, your master link might sit in your Instagram bio and open a page that lists your latest video, online store, newsletter, and contact form in one place.

How to put multiple links in one Excel cell?
Excel supports only one standard hyperlink per cell, so you cannot include multiple clickable URLs in a single cell using standard methods. As a workaround, you can place several short labels in nearby cells, each with its own hyperlink, and style them so they look like a group.
Another way is to add a single link in a cell, then press Ctrl + Enter or Alt + Enter. This lets you add another URL or link, and, following the same process, you can add as many links as you want in a single cell. But this is too frustrating if you have a very long list of links at hand.
One more option is to insert shapes or text boxes on top of a cell, then assign each shape its own link. For most people, it is easier to move the link list to a small web page or document and then share one master link to that page.

What is a temporary URL?
A temporary URL, also known as an expiring link, is a web link that is only valid for a limited period. It allows you to share content such as documents, files, or web pages with others while ensuring that access to that content expires after a specific duration.
This temporary access helps maintain control over who can view the content and for how long, making it particularly useful for securely sharing sensitive or time-sensitive information. Once the expiration has passed, the URL becomes invalid, preventing further access to the shared content.
Temporary URLs are commonly used in various scenarios, including sharing confidential documents, distributing promotional materials for a limited time, and granting temporary access to private web pages or resources.

Why is it called “Black Friday”?
Black Friday was first used in 1869 when two investors, Jim Fisk and Jay Gould, crashed the market by dropping gold prices. As a result, foreign trade stopped, the stock market dropped by 20%, and farmers witnessed an unfortunate drop in wheat and corn values.
From 1950 to 1960, the term was used again for a day between the Army-navy game and Thanksgiving; the event summoned crowds of tourists and shoppers, requiring an extra few hours of effort by law enforcement to moderate the traffic.
In 1980, the term associated with shopping was used when retailers used the Black Friday term to reflect the backstory of accountants who used red ink for negative earnings and black for positive earnings.
Black Friday became the day when stores turned their profitability.
Since then, the term “Black Friday” has been in use. It has evolved into a season-long event that has spawned more shopping holidays like “Cyber Monday” and “Small Business Saturday”.

What is a hyperlink?
A hyperlink, often simply called a link, is a reference in a digital document that directs users to another location when they click on it. This destination can be a different section of the same document, another document, a webpage, a downloadable file, or any other online resource.
For example, academic sources, research documents, or service platforms like Paperwriter.com can all be linked directly for quick access within your content.
Hyperlinks are fundamental to the web’s structure, enabling easy navigation and connectivity between various pieces of information. They can be displayed as text, images, or other elements. Text hyperlinks are usually underlined and colored differently from the surrounding text to indicate they are clickable.

Adding links to your Tumblr bio: What you need to know
Before you start linking up your Tumblr bio, here’s the lowdown:
You’ll need to use some basic HTML code for this. No worries, it’s simple.
Tumblr doesn’t have a fancy button for adding links. You’ll have to do a bit of copy-paste action with the HTML code.
Adding a link in bio is a cool way to connect your visitors to your other social media or special works. It makes your Tumblr world a bit more interactive.
Don’t worry if it sounds a bit technical, we’ll keep it super simple. All you need to do is view HTML code, copy and paste a little code. No need to stress; let’s make your Tumblr bio awesome together!
Follow these steps to add links to your Tumblr bio:
Step 1: Go to the Tumblr website and log in to your account using your credentials.
Step 2: Click on “Setting” in the left-side menu.
Step 3: Look for the “Blogs” section at the bottom of the right-side menu and click it.
Step 4: In the blog setting, click on the “Edit Theme” button.
Step 4: Look for a section called “Title” and “Description”. This is where you can input information about yourself.
Step 5: To add a link, use standard HTML anchor tags. The format is as follows:
<a href="URL">Link Text</a>
Replace “URL” with the actual link and “Link Text” with the text you want to display for the link.
For example:
<a href="https://replug.io/">Visit my website</a>
Add this in the description section.
Step 6: After adding your link, save the changes. It should appear in your Tumblr bio.
Simply confirm that the link looks right by visiting your Tumblr blog. Check your bio, and if everything is as expected, your link is good to go! Your Tumblr bio now features the link, allowing visitors to click and explore the connected website hassle-free.
